A true Blue Marans is a rare bird most blues are over melanized blue coppers.....best thing is to find a black birchen with good egg color and breed it in otherwise you will hatch out split males (1/2 silver 1/2 copper) since black coppers are a birchen just with the copper....... and I hope I explained it well enough. There are a few breeders with birchens that have good egg color and even type. If you belong to the Marans club it has breeders listed and you can get on the waiting list.....most birchens though need work on their size and egg color.....as you can tell from reading the thread breeding good Marans is not an easy task.

Well, you are in the Marans thread, so I'm going to say, Marans!
lol.png


Do you want the rooster for the dark egg gene? Then go Marans. Do you want a flock protector? My Marans boys are all good protectors of the flock. As for the missing tail feathers, he is either molting or getting help with molting from one of your other birds, like maybe the Barred Rock roo? Hens will also pull feathers out of birds lower in the pecking order.​
